Position Overview:
As an Industrial Trainee (IPL Graduate), you will play a vital role in supporting the Program Core Team and will be actively involved in launching new programs within the plant. This hands-on internship offers a unique opportunity to gain real-world experience in a high-paced production environment, helping bridge the gap between academic knowledge and practical application.
Key Responsibilities:
1. Team Management:
- Serve as the liaison between the Program Core Team and the plant.
- Define and manage the Plant Program Launch Team’s required resources.
- Actively participate in Advanced Product Quality Planning (APQP) meetings and design reviews.
2. Process Definition & Production System Development:
- Support the definition of manufacturing processes and conduct feasibility and capability studies.
- Maintain accurate documentation within ERP systems, including PBOMs and routings.
- Implement process and product changes aligned with Faurecia’s standards.
- Assist in defining production lines using standard methodologies.
- Validate the design and functionality of equipment, tools, and gauges with suppliers.
3. Production Launch:
- Support the plant in preparing for and managing production ramp-up phases.
- Implement all actions derived from Process FMEA.
- Oversee process qualification and the Production Part Approval Process (PPAP).
4. Targets and Reporting:
- Track and report progress on key metrics such as scrap rates, rework, cycle times, material costs, and launch budgets.
- Ensure timely and accurate reporting to the Program Core Team.
